It simply means "hell naw", but it really means "no." It's used to describe surprise and opposition towards a comment and/or situation. usually in a major way WOMAN: I need a huge favor. MAN: What. WOMAN: Will you pay my rent and bills? I'll give you something to make it worth your while. MAN: HELL TO THE NAW!!!!!!!! You just gonna use me, then set me up.
